Environmental Concerns Over Plastic Grass
The introduction of plastic grass in Hoylake, a coastal town known for its scenic beauty, has sparked a lively debate. The environmental implications of replacing natural grass with synthetic alternatives are a major point of contention.
- Ecological Impact: Natural grass acts as a natural habitat for insects and small animals. Artificial grass, on the other hand, offers no such support, potentially disrupting local ecosystems.
- Plastic Waste: The production and eventual disposal of synthetic grass contribute to the ever-growing problem of plastic waste.
- Heat Retention: Artificial grass can absorb and retain heat, leading to increased local temperatures. This phenomenon is particularly concerning in coastal areas where natural cooling is crucial.

Benefits of Artificial Grass on Coastal Areas
The argument for plastic grass is compelling, especially when considering the unique challenges posed by coastal environments.
- Reduced Maintenance: Unlike natural grass, synthetic turf requires no watering, mowing, or fertilizing, making it an attractive option for areas that struggle with harsh weather conditions.
- Durability: Plastic grass can withstand strong coastal winds and salt exposure better than natural grass, offering a more resilient landscape solution.
- Aesthetic Appeal: Artificial grass maintains its vibrant green appearance year-round, enhancing the visual appeal of public spaces and private gardens.
